Abstract
This article presents results of a complex research project having the goal to develop and validate a set of techniques and structures enabling adaptive applications and services in communications. We are approaching adaptivity and dynamic reconfiguration at multiple levels: the applications and the software infrastructure from each terminal, and the communication network, here with a focus on cellular data networks. A coherent approach of all these levels is needed in order to define a complete solution. At the level of applications and their software infrastructure, we approach dynamic automatic adaptation by solving the following problems: the decisional problem that handles finding a configuration that fits the current imposed requirements, and the infrastructure problem of dynamically mapping structural changes on the implementation. At the level of the communication network, we develop improved strategies for resource allocation in cellular data networks, including user admission control, in order to provide differentiated QoS, even during congested periods and with variable quality of the radio link.
